CVE-2025-49661
HIGHCVSS 7.8/10EPSS 0.35%
Last modified
CVE-2025-49661 is a high-severity vulnerability rated 7.8/10 on the CVSS scale. Untrusted pointer dereference in Windows Ancillary Function Driver for WinSock allows an authorized attacker to elevate privileges locally.. EPSS estimates a 0.35% chance of exploitation in the next 30 days.
Description
Untrusted pointer dereference in Windows Ancillary Function Driver for WinSock allows an authorized attacker to elevate privileges locally.
Metrics
CVSS:3.1/AV:L/AC:L/PR:L/UI:N/S:U/C:H/I:H/A:H

Affected Software
| Vendor | Product | Versions | Update |
|---|---|---|---|
| Microsoft | Windows 10 1507 | < 10.0.10240.21073 | — |
| Microsoft | Windows 10 1607 | < 10.0.14393.8246 | — |
| Microsoft | Windows 10 1809 | < 10.0.17763.7558 | — |
| Microsoft | Windows 10 21h2 | < 10.0.19044.6093 | — |
| Microsoft | Windows 10 22h2 | < 10.0.19045.6093 | — |
| Microsoft | Windows 11 22h2 | < 10.0.22621.5624 | — |
| Microsoft | Windows 11 23h2 | < 10.0.22631.5624 | — |
| Microsoft | Windows 11 24h2 | < 10.0.26100.4652 | — |
| Microsoft | Windows Server 2008 | All versions | Sp2 |
| Microsoft | Windows Server 2008 | r2 | Sp1 |
| Microsoft | Windows Server 2012 | All versions | — |
| Microsoft | Windows Server 2012 | r2 | — |
| Microsoft | Windows Server 2016 | < 10.0.14393.8246 | — |
| Microsoft | Windows Server 2019 | < 10.0.17763.7558 | — |
| Microsoft | Windows Server 2022 | < 10.0.20348.3932 | — |
| Microsoft | Windows Server 2022 23h2 | < 10.0.25398.1732 | — |
| Microsoft | Windows Server 2025 | < 10.0.26100.4652 | — |
